I've been playing with accessibility and ChatGPT. For people (e.g. with ADHD) who find it easier to read when the first half of each word in a passage is bolded, you can put passages into ChatGPT and ask it to rewrite this way.

Our newest resource on childhood concussions is now available! The infographic talks about what to expect at emerg, steps to recovery, and what follow-up care to expect. It also includes info sheets that can be shared with coaches, teachers, and friends. echokt.ca/concussion
